Hair Loss LLMs: What the AI Knows (and Doesn't)

Large Language Models LLMs are increasingly being employed to tackle concerns around alopecia. These advanced tools can present information on potential causes, current treatments, and even summarize research findings. However, it's essential to recognize their limitations: LLMs acquire from vast datasets of text and code, but they lack the clinical judgment of a experienced dermatologist or healthcare expert. They can create plausible-sounding but inaccurate guidance , and should never substitute personalized evaluations and treatment plans. Therefore, use them as informative resources, but always speak with a doctor before making any decisions about your hair condition .
